titleOfInvention | Fungus cellulose enzyme system constitution/characteristic regulation gene and application thereof |
abstract | The invention relates to a fungus cellulose enzyme system constitution/characteristic regulation gene and application thereof. Nucleotide sequences are demonstrated in SEQ ID No.1 or SEQ ID No.4. The invention further relates to fungus cellulose enzyme activity regulation factors coded by fungus cellulose enzyme activity regulation genes, and the application of the fungus cellulose enzyme activity regulation genes in preparation of special fungus cellulose enzyme. Amino acid sequences are demonstrated in SEQ ID No.2 or SEQ ID No.5. The fungus cellulose enzyme activity regulation genes and the fungus cellulose enzyme activity regulation factors can be used for regulating enzyme activity of cellulose enzyme in fungus. After a knockout box replaces the fungus cellulose enzyme activity regulation genes, compared with original strains, the enzyme activity of cellulose enzyme can be changed about 20% so as to meet requirements of various industries for the enzyme activity of different cellulose enzyme. |
